Common Building Foundation Repair Jobs
Foundation Crack Repair - addresses and seals cracks to prevent further damage and maintain structural integrity.
Settling Foundation Repair - stabilizes shifting foundations caused by soil movement or moisture changes.
Pier and Beam Foundation Repair - reinforces or replaces piers to support sagging or uneven floors.
Concrete Slab Repair - fixes cracks and voids in concrete slabs to improve stability and safety.
Basement Foundation Repair - repairs leaks, cracks, and bowing walls to protect against water intrusion.
Foundation Underpinning - strengthens and raises the foundation to correct settlement issues.
Building Foundation Repair Questions
What are signs of foundation problems? Common sign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and doors or windows that stick or don’t close properly.
What causes foundation issues? Foundation problems can result from soil settling, moisture changes, poor drainage, or tree roots exerting pressure on the foundation.
How is foundation repair typically done? Repair methods may involve underpinning, piering, or stabilization techniques to restore stability and prevent further damage.
When should property owners consider foundation repair? Repair is advisable when signs of movement or damage are noticeable, especially if they worsen over time or affect the building’s safety.
